I painted my engine block and after looking at it I have decided that I hate it. Can I just scuff it up and spray the new paint or should I strip the block again and start over?
What kind of paint did you use? Aerosol, acrylic enamel, BC/CC? And how long ago? It makes a difference!
The best way is to get most of it off. The thing that kills paint on engines, besides the burning close to the exhast manifold, is too much thickness. I wouldn't get too **** with it, just scuff off, or wire wheel it as best you can.
